  • Getting ready for the Installation


    Firstly, the sustaining structure provided with the bathroom ought to be fitted (if required) according to the manufacturer's guidelines. Next off, fit the faucets or mixer to the tub. When fitting the faucet block, it is necessary to make certain that if the tap comes with a plastic washing machine, it is fitted in between the bath and the faucets. On a plastic bathroom, it is likewise sensible to fit a sustaining plate under the faucets system to prevent pressure on the tub.
    Fit the versatile tap adapters to the bottom of both taps using 2 nuts and olives (occasionally provided with the tub). Fit the plug-hole electrical outlet by smearing mastic filler round the sink electrical outlet hole, and then pass the electrical outlet with the hole in the bath. Make use of the nut supplied by the manufacturer to fit the plug-hole. Check out the plug-hole outlet for an inlet on the side for the overflow pipe.
    Next off, fit the end of the adaptable overflow pipeline to the overflow outlet. Afterwards, screw the pipe to the overflow face which should be fitted inside the bathroom. Ensure you make use of every one of the supplied washing machines.
    Link the catch to the bottom of the waste outlet on the bathtub by winding the string of the waste outlet with silicone mastic or PTFE tape, and also screw on the trap to the electrical outlet. Connect all-time low of the overflow tube in a comparable manner.The bath need to now prepare to be suited its final placement.

    Removing Old Taps


    If you need to change old taps with brand-new ones as a part of your installment, then the first thing you need to do is disconnect the water system. After doing so, activate the taps to drain pipes any water staying in the system. The procedure of removing the existing taps can be rather bothersome due to the limited accessibility that is frequently the situation.
    Make use of a basin wrench (crowsfoot spanner) or a tap device to reverse the nut that connects the supply pipelines to the faucets. Have a cloth prepared for the staying water that will certainly come from the pipes. When the supply pipelines have been removed, utilize the very same device to loosen the nut that holds the taps onto the bath/basin. You will require to quit the solitary taps from turning during this procedure. As soon as the faucets have been removed, the holes in the bath/basin will need to be cleansed of any kind of old sealing compound.
    Before carrying on to fit the brand-new faucets, compare the pipe connections on the old taps to the new faucets. If the old faucets are longer than the brand-new faucets, after that a shank adapter is required for the new taps to fit.

    Setting up the Tub


    Utilizing both wood boards under its feet, position the bath tub in the required position. The wooden boards are valuable in uniformly spreading out the weight of the tub over the location of the boards as opposed to concentrating all the weight onto 4 tiny factors.
    The following objective is to ensure that the bathtub is leveled all round. This can be achieved by checking the spirit level and adjusting the feet on the bathtub until the spirit level reads level.
    To install taps, fit the bottom of the furthest flexible faucet adapter to the ideal supply pipeline by making a compression sign up with; after that do the very same for the various other faucet.
    Turn on the water system and check all joints and new pipework for leakages and also tighten them if essential. Fill up the tub and also check the overflow electrical outlet and also the regular electrical outlet for leaks.
    Finally, fix the bathroom paneling as defined in the maker's instruction manual. Tiling and sealing around the bath tub needs to wait up until the tub has been made use of a minimum of once as this will resolve it right into its final position.

    Suitable New Touches


    If the tails of the brand-new taps are plastic, then you will certainly require a plastic connector to avoid damage to the thread. One end of the adapter fits on the plastic tail of the faucet as well as the other end gives a link to the existing supply pipes.
    If you require to fit a monobloc, then you will call for minimizing couplers, which connects the 10mm pipeline of the monobloc to the common 15mm supply pipe.
    Next off, position the tap in the placing hole in the bath/basin ensuring that the washing machines are in place in between the tap and also the sink. Safeguard the tap in position with the maker offered backnut. As soon as the faucet is securely in position, the supply pipes can be attached to the tails of the faucets. The taps can either be attached by using corrugated copper piping or with regular tap adapters. The previous type must be connected to the faucet ends initially, tightening just by hand. The supply pipes can later on be linked to the other end. Tighten up both ends with a spanner after both ends have been attached.

    Tiling Around the Bathtub


    In the location where the bath fulfills the tile, it is essential to seal the accompanies a silicone rubber caulking. This is important as the fitting can relocate enough to fracture a stiff seal, triggering the water to penetrate the wall surface between the bathroom and the tiling, bring about problems with dampness as well as possible leakages to the ceiling below.
    You can pick from a range of coloured sealers to blend in your components as well as installations. They are offered in tubes and also cartridges, as well as can sealing voids as much as a size of 3mm (1/8 inch). If you have a larger void to fill, you can load it with twists of drenched newspaper or soft rope. Keep in mind to constantly fill up the bath tub with water before securing, to allow for the motion experienced when the tub is in usage. The sealer can crack relatively very early if you do not consider this motion prior to securing.
    Alternatively, ceramic coving or quadrant tiles can be utilized to border the bath or shower tray. Plastic strips of coving, which are easy to use and cut to size, are likewise quickly readily available on the marketplace. It is advisable to fit the tiles using water-resistant or water resistant sticky as well as grout.

    How to Install a Freestanding Bathtub?


    Installing a freestanding bathtub or any kind of bathtub is not a difficult task if you have a sophisticated guide on installing a freestanding bathtub in your bathroom. Aside from getting the freestanding bathtub to your bathroom, you can do all the work without paying a plumber. A bathroom with a bathtub is a retreat where you can feel the sensation of coming home and soaking in that hot water. It is a great way to remove all the stress from your day.



    This guide will walk you through installing a freestanding bathtub in simple steps and help you find relief.


    Slope


    Make sure your bathroom has a proper slope. If your floor lacks a slope, the water flow to the drain will not function, which leads to a blocked drain which can cost you money. You can use the level device to see your bathroom's vertical and horizontal aspects. Once you have that information, you must carry out the next step.


    Placement


    A freestanding bathtub has a unique characteristic that helps you bring elegance to your bathroom. A freestanding bathtub comes in various sizes and shapes suitable for different types of bathrooms.



    According to the information you gathered from the level device, you must pick a bathtub that suits your style and fits your bathroom aesthetically. You can place a freestanding bathtub virtually anywhere, such as in the corner, near the wall, or even at the center of your bathroom. However, you must ensure proper plumbing where you want to install the tub. If not, then you must call a plumber.


    Clean the bathroom floor


    After deciding where to place the bathtub, you must clean the entire bathroom floor so that the dust and debris do not accumulate underneath the tub. Simple cleaning is enough, and you will clean it again after the installation.


    Steps to Install a Freestanding Bathtub:


    STEP 1: Place the protective blanket in the adjacent area where you want to install the bathtub. It will help you protect the bathtub's sides when you do the installation.



    STEP 2: Now, place the 4x4 lumber in the area where you want to install the bathtub. Place the bathtub on top of the lumber, and align the drain line with the bathtub drain.



    STEP 3: A freestanding bathtub comes with a drain kit. If not, make sure you purchase one with your bathtub. You can pop that drain kit and align it with your bathroom drain line. Ensure that you tighten the drain nut enough so there is no water leakage. You must also clean the bathtub’s drain to remove the factory dirt and debris.



    STEP 4: Clean the drain hole in your bathroom. It helps to do the installation without any water blockage. A drain cleaner or bleach will suffice. Once the drain dries entirely, take a small amount of clear silicon and place it around the underside of the pipe flange.



    STEP 5: Attach the drain tailpiece to the bottom of the bathtub. Place the rubber or plastic bushing with the plumbing material at the top of the tailpiece and screw the drain nut up the tube until it tightens both the bathtub’s drain and the drain tailpiece. Now you must add the lubricant to the seal to ensure there is no water leakage in the pipe connection.



    STEP 6: Place caulk around the bottom edge of the bathtub. Take out the lumbar support and carefully bring the bathtub to the floor. Use a damp cloth to clean the excess caulk and debris and plumber putty to cover the tub drains and the floor.


    Tips to Maintain a Freestanding Bathtub:


  • Always look for the clog in the drain. You can pull it out with a small stick if hair or debris is in the gutter.


  • Use mild cleaning components, which will help you preserve the bathtub for a long time and will also help you remove surface-level scratches.


  • Do not use strong solutions such as concentrated bleach to remove stains. Instead, mix water and diluted bleach with a ratio of 10:2, respectively. Apply it to the tub's surface and leave it for 15-20 minutes to remove any surface-level stains.


  • Always check the floor drain. You may unclog it using any small sticks or a small vacuum to suck out all the debris.


  • Check the heater or faucet immediately if you smell rust or grease in the water. Rust in the water may stain or damage the bathtub in the long run.


  • If you want to sand the bathtub, try using 400 grit sandpaper or 600 grit sandpaper for a more refined finish.
